346.0 institutions hold shares in eXp World Holdings Inc (EXPI), with institutional investors hold 73.55% of the company’s shares. The shares outstanding are 156.17M, and float is at 85.97M with Short Float at 19.88%. Institutions hold 40.74% of the Float.

The top institutional shareholder in the company is BLACKROCK INC. with over 12.04 million shares valued at $135.84 million. The investor’s holdings represent 7.8378 of the EXPI Shares outstanding. As of 2024-06-30, the second largest holder is VANGUARD GROUP INC with 12.02 million shares valued at $135.63 million to account for 7.8259 of the shares outstanding. The other top investors are COPELAND CAPITAL MANAGEMENT, LLC which holds 3.92 million shares representing 2.5504 and valued at over $44.2 million, while STATE STREET CORP holds 1.8653 of the shares totaling 2.86 million with a market value of $32.33 million.

eXp World Holdings Inc (EXPI) Insider Activity

The most recent transaction is an insider sale by MILES RANDALL D, the company’s Director. SEC filings show that MILES RANDALL D sold 10,000 shares of the company’s common stock on Jun 10 ’25 at a price of $9.15 per share for a total of $91500.0. Following the sale, the insider now owns 0.54 million shares.

Still, SEC filings show that on May 19 ’25, Sanford Glenn Darrel (CEO and Chairman of the Board) disposed off 25,000 shares at an average price of $7.99 for $0.2 million. The insider now directly holds 39,628,400 shares of eXp World Holdings Inc (EXPI).
